SMART Recovery
Self-Management and Recovery Training. It is a non-profit, science based program that helps people recover from addictive behaviors. Addictive Behaviors can be alcohol, smoking, drugs, gambling, sex, eating, shopping, self-harm etc. No matter what addictive behavior you are not alone. This is a donation based group and we suggest a 5$ donation but all are welcome.

SMART Recovery for Family and Friends
This group is for people affected by the addictive behavior of a loved one. This group used REBT, CBT, and CRAFT principles to help loved ones how to interact with the addicted person and how to work on their own self-care while they cope with the challenges of loving someone who has an addictive behavior. This group is donation based and we suggest a 5$ donation per visit.

Circles for Reconciliation
Circles for Reconciliation is an Indigenous-led non-profit corporation based in Canada, aimed at fostering meaningful relationships between Indigenous and non-Indigenous peoples. This is done through the creation of small discussion circles, each consisting of an equal number of Indigenous and non-Indigenous participants. These circles, led by trained facilitators, meet regularly to promote understanding and respect, key elements of reconciliation. The organization's efforts align with the 94 Calls to Action from the Truth and Reconciliation Commission.
